#82729c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#82729c is composed of 51% red, 44.7% green and 61.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16.7% cyan, 26.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 262.9 degrees, a saturation of 17.5% and a lightness of 52.9%. #82729c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e4ff with #050039. Closest websafe color is: #996699.

Shades and Tints of #82729c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070609 is the darkest color, while #fdfcfd is the lightest one.
